Since Darwin published "On the Origin of Species," a lot of new evidence has surfaced that supports the close evolutionary connection between humans and chimpanzees. For one, genetic studies have revealed that human and chimpanzee DNA is incredibly similar, with a 98-99% match, underscoring our shared ancestry. The fossil record has also expanded, with discoveries like Australopithecus afarensis, famously known as "Lucy," which show transitional features between ape-like ancestors and modern humans. Additionally, comparative anatomy has highlighted similar structures between the two, such as dental patterns and thumb proportions. On the biochemical side, proteins and other molecular markers show significant likenesses. Even the behaviors of chimpanzees show complexity and social traits that resemble humans. If researchers back in Darwin's time had access to this kind of evidence, his ideas might have gained more popularity. The genetic and fossil evidence, in particular, would have provided strong, tangible proof that could persuade skeptics and lessen the debates rooted in the lack of anatomical data at the time. While societal and religious attitudes might still have posed challenges due to the implications of common ancestry with primates, the scientific community would likely have embraced Darwin's ideas more enthusiastically with such robust backing.
